What’s Included and How It Works

For just over $17, you get access to Adventure Hunt’s app, which you download in advance or on the spot. The app is compatible in English, Spanish, Italian, French, German, and Dutch, opening the activity to a wide range of visitors. It’s important to note that there’s no additional equipment needed, aside from your mobile phone with internet access and GPS. To make the most of your experience, ensure your phone is fully charged, so you don’t run into issues midway.

Once you start, the game offers 21 clues over 2.6km for the standard route, or 35 clues over 4.5km if you opt for the extended version. Both options are set near the coast, making for a pleasant walk and plenty of chances to soak in the seaside atmosphere.

What To Expect During Your Walk

You’ll begin your adventure at the C.C. Pueblo Canario shopping center, a convenient starting point in Costa Adeje. As you follow the clues, you’ll uncover interesting sights and hidden corners of the area. The clues are designed to test your observation, memory, and logic skills, all while encouraging lighthearted fun with friends or family.

According to reviews, the clues are typically quick to solve, with most taking less than five minutes. But if you’re stuck, hints are available, and explanations follow for those tricky puzzles. For those who prefer a more straightforward experience, the game allows you to skip clues and keep moving, which keeps the experience enjoyable rather than frustrating.

Practical Considerations

  • Timing: Book at least 5 days in advance if you want to secure your preferred time, though same-day bookings are sometimes possible.
  • Group Size: Up to 6 people, making it ideal for small groups or families.
  • Duration: Expect about 2 hours, but you can take longer if you wish.
  • Accessibility: Most travelers can participate, and service animals are allowed.
  • Starting Point: The activity begins conveniently at C.C. Pueblo Canario, near public transportation.

Frequently Asked Questions

Do I need a special app or equipment?
No, you simply need your smartphone with internet access and GPS. The Adventure Hunt app is included in the price and available in multiple languages.

How long does the activity take?
The standard route takes approximately 2 hours, but you’re free to take longer or shorter based on your pace and interest.

Can I do this activity with children?
Yes, it’s designed for children over 12-13, but younger children can join in as well. The clues are generally quick to solve, making it suitable for a family outing.

Is the activity suitable in all weather conditions?
Since most of the route is outdoors along the coast, it’s best to avoid days with heavy rain or extreme heat. However, the activity itself is flexible, and you can pause or skip clues if needed.

What if I get stuck on a clue?
Hints are available within the app, and explanations follow for any clues you find difficult. You can also choose to skip and move on.

Is it a guided tour?
No, it’s self-guided, giving you the freedom to explore at your own pace without a guide or scheduled group.

Where does the activity start and end?
It begins at C.C. Pueblo Canario and ends back at the same spot, making it easy to plan your day.

What’s the recommended group size?
Up to 6 people per booking, which is perfect for small groups or families.

Can I cancel if my plans change?
Yes, free cancellation is available up to 24 hours before your scheduled start, allowing flexibility if your plans shift.
